#9b980a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9b980a is composed of 60.8% red, 59.6% green and 3.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 1.9% magenta, 93.5% yellow and 39.2% black. It has a hue angle of 58.8 degrees, a saturation of 87.9% and a lightness of 32.4%. #9b980a color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ff14 with #373100. Closest websafe color is: #999900.

Shades and Tints of #9b980a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080700 is the darkest color, while #fefef4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#9b980a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#555550 is the less saturated color, while #a19e04 is the most saturated one.
